There are a number of means to discover at home treatment. Recommendations from health and wellness care experts and others who have utilized at home care might be the ideal resource of top quality treatment providers.

When employing a freelance caregiver, bear in mind prices connected to being a company. Freelance caregivers do not certify as "Independent Professionals" according to tax obligation and labor laws.

Fines can look at more info be imposed and back tax obligations plus penalties can build up. Job relevant injuries could not be covered by your home owner's insurance coverage. Live-in caregivers who utilize your home as their primary home may be considered a renter. This might complicate points ought to you require to end he or she's solution. You should constantly talk to tax obligation insurance and lawful professionals if you pick to employ a freelance caretaker.

What is their job history? Worker application forms are offered at workplace supply stores, and can be utilized for each prospective employee. It is additionally essential to validate that this person can legitimately function in the United States.

Fines ranging from $250 to $2,000 can be imposed on those that hire illegal immigrants. Likewise, be certain to have a written arrangement with the caretaker to avoid prospective wage and labor conflicts. For assurance, you may intend to utilize firms or windows registries that offer pre-screened caretakers for you to work with directly.

Agencies and business that do background checks can be discovered see it here in the Telephone directory or online. Another option for discovering caretakers is through a company. At home care companies usually use qualified and bound team that perform a variety of jobs. While it might be more costly to work with a caregiver via a company, you will certainly not be in charge of prices such as bookkeeping, insurance coverage and tax obligations.



Locate out about the firm. Compare costs, services and attributes that they supply. Remember, you are the client, and ultimately you have to really feel comfy and confident with the caregiver's solutions.

Some firms provide higher degrees of treatment such as incontinence care, heavy transfers and Alzheimer's treatment. Have the firm plainly state in composing what solutions are offered. Some companies have minimal numbers of hours per shift. Some offer change rates. Some charge more for vacations, nights and weekends. Ask which holidays are observed by the company.
